West Brom keeper Foster convinced England can win silverware

West Bromwich Albion goalkeeper Ben Foster feels England are capable of winning something under Roy Hodgson.

Foster is now hopeful England can rid themselves of the tag of perennial under-achievers.

He said: "I think it's likely we could do a lot better than we have in the past."

"My memories are the same as everybody else's, a lot of hype and then usually out in the quarter-finals.

"It would be nice to kick on and do a little bit more than that now."
